LNWR Coach Body

LNWR Coach Body cut from Styrene of varying thicknesses in 7mm/ft.

The coach body side and bolections are cut from 0.5mm styrene while the beading is cut from 0.25mm thick.

The coach itself is built around an internal box structure made from 1.0mm styrene. This method of construction was used by David Jenkinson and is described in detail in his book "Carriage Modelling Made Easy ISBN 1 874103 32 1". Although this book appears to be out of print it can still be obtained at Motor Books (UK) or 3mmScale Model Railways amongst others.

Two views of the coach without the roof. These show the internal box construction upon which formers are glued to form the "tumble home" (curved sides) of the outside walls of the coach.

A view of the underside of the coach roof. It is constructed entirely of styrene laser cut components.
